5 Things to Consider When Looking for an on-Demand Water Heater

When shopping around for a water heater, property owners in Austin, Texas, have many factors to consider. From choosing the correct fuel source to understanding the advancement in heating technology, here are five top tips that will aid property owners in selecting an on-demand water heater that meets their needs.

1. Fuel Type

When it comes to water heaters, there are three main types of fuel used – gas, electric, and solar. Each has their pros and cons, so it's important to consider the cost of each fuel type, energy requirements, space requirements, and the climate in which the water heater will be installed. Those living in Austin will likely find that gas and electric are the best fuel sources as they produce reliable, cost-efficient heat year-round even during the cold winter months.

2. Energy Efficiency

When selecting an on-demand water heater, property owners should look for one that is energy efficient. Selecting a model with the right Energy Factor (EF) can help save money on energy bills for years to come. Be sure to check the EF numbers and compare them to each other to ensure you're making an informed decision.

3. Size & Capacity

It's important to select a water heater with the correct size and capacity to ensure that it is able to meet the needs of the property. The size of the heaters will vary, as will the amount of hot water they are able to produce each hour. Make sure to consider the number of occupants in the home and their typical water usage patterns when selecting a size and capacity for the tank.

4. Installation & Maintenance

On-demand water heaters are usually easier to install than their traditional counterparts, mostly because they don't require a vent or tank. However, it is important to make sure the unit is correctly installed to ensure it operates safely and efficiently. Additionally, regular maintenance is necessary to make sure the water heater is functioning correctly and to identify and fix any potential problems before they become serious.

5. Warranties & Assistance

Finally, it's important to carefully read the warranties and service agreements that come with the water heater. If there are any discrepancies, it is better to deal with the problem now, as opposed to later. Many manufacturers will offer additional services and assistance for installation and repairs, so be sure to ask about these as well.
